Airtel Uganda to restructure its Sales and Distribution team

BigEyeUg3By BigEyeUg3October 20, 2015
Share
Facebook Twitter Telegram WhatsApp

Airtel logo

Airtel Uganda has today announced a restructuring that will see the business streamline its operations in Sales & Distribution.

“We are implementing a revised strategic plan to better align the sales and distribution team to the business priorities,” said Tom Gutjahr the Airtel Uganda MD.

“The Airtel brand in Uganda continues to grow, the restructuring is needed to ensure that our go to market model is appropriate for business conditions and that our operations remain competitive,” he further said.

The new way of working is an opportunity for Airtel to get even closer to their customer, and with it, they shall be sourcing for more talent to join the existing Airtel Sales and Distribution team.
